If you have a list of target companies in your ICP and want Duo Copilot to monitor signals only for those accounts, you can do this by narrowing the audience for each Duo signal. This is useful for when you want Duo to look for relevant leads only within a defined company list.
How to add a list of companies to a Duo signal
Go to Settings > Duo Copilot.
Open the signal you want to configure.
Go to Stage 2: Filters.
Find the Current Company filter.
Paste the list of companies you want Duo to track.
Click Save Changes.
Once saved, Duo will only surface leads from companies that match the companies in that filter.

Can I use a CRM company list instead?
If your CRM is connected, you can also use a CRM-based company list or report to define the companies Duo should monitor. This is useful when the target account list already lives in HubSpot or Salesforce.
Go to Settings > Duo Copilot.
Open the signal you want to configure.
Go to Stage 2: Filters.
Find the CRM Based Filters.
Choose the list or report that contains companies you want Duo to track.
Click Save Changes.

Do I need to import contacts, or can I import companies?
If your goal is to monitor target accounts and find relevant people at those accounts, you do not need to start with a contact list. You can define the companies first, and Duo will use the signal configuration and filters to surface relevant leads from those companies.
Will Duo enrich those companies and find contacts?
Yes. When Duo is configured to monitor a list of companies, it can surface relevant leads at those companies based on the signal and filter criteria.
